Attitudes towards traditional products. The president of south korea has lashed out at the captain and some crew members of the ferry that sank last week. Park geunhye compared their actions to murder. Prosecutors are investigating whether those in charge of the ship did enough to help the hundreds of passengers who were trapped inside. Translator the conduct of the captain and some crew members is unfathomable from the viewpoints of common sense, and it was like an act of murder that cannot and should not be tolerated. Park says the captain and some crew told passengers to stay where they were, then escaped first. She saids that legally and ethically, unimaginable. Prosecutors have already arrested the the captain and two crew members. They say four other crew are suspected of leaving passengers unattended resulting in their deaths. PRC Court recognises an English judgment for the first time – a Gard perspective

On March 17, 2022, the Shanghai Maritime Court (following approval from the Supreme People’s Court) issued a ruling confirming that English High Court judgments can be recognised and enforced in the People’s Republic of China.
